Abstract
The Asian Development Bank (ADB) has supported the Government of Papua New Guinea (PNG) and the PNG Power Limited to construct a 150-kilometer high voltage transmission line linking the West New Britain Provincial capital Kimbe and the township of Bialla. The transmission line will connect renewable energy from existing hydropower and biomass facilities and bring electricity to households, schools, and medical clinics along the alignment.
